By doing so the watchface stays free of charge for you in the future. The watchface consists of a dial on the round border and 8 small circles. The dial shows the seconds and the clock's hours. You can customize the dial and the colors to your needs. The clock's minutes are shown as a big pie in the middle. You can customize that color as well to your needs. The dial shows also the sun rise in yellow and sun set in red. The 8 small circles show progress. There are 4 circles on the left hand side and 4 on the right hand side. Those on the left hand side show the progress of your activity goals as pies (steps, floors, intensity minutes and calories). Furthermore each circle contains out of a small indicator which circles on the outer border of the cirlce. This small indicator shows the current value of the activity. The current step indicator has to be multiplied with 2000. E. g. if the indicator is at the 3 o'clock mark you were gone 6000 steps. The current floors indicator has to be multiplied with 2. So the indicator can show 24 floors before it begins to count newly. The intensity minutes has to be multiplied with 20. So the indicator can show 240 minutes. The calories indicator has to be multiplied with 200. So the indicator can show 2400 kC before it begins newly. It takes some time until you are used to that but if you got it, it's very easy. The four circles on the right hand side shows: date, heartrate, inactivity and battery: Date circle: the pie diagram can show 12 days. For an entire month 31 days are needed. Therefore the color of the pie changes: green for day 1-12, yellow for day 13-24 and red for 25-31. The little indicator on the outside of the pie diagram shows the day of the week beginning with 1 o'clock. You can adjust in the settings whether your week starts on monday or on sunday. Heartrate circle: The pie diagram shows the heart rate. The scale of this pie diagram is 1-60. If your heart rate is below 60, the color of the pie is green, below 120, the color is yellow, otherwise it's red. The two indicators on the dial show the min and max heart rate values. The user can decide whether min and max values of the stored history are shown or the daily min/max values. The history period differs from watch to watch. If you want to know your period you could temporarily activate the debug switch in the settings which gives you the duration, the min and the max value from top to down. The daily min/max values are got via a clever algorithm. Inactivity circle: The pie diagram shows the inactivity. It kicks in if 60 minutes of inactivity are recognized. After that it counts every single minute. If you see a full pie: just move to clear it. Around the dial of the inactivity circle the alarm count is shown. Note that it kicks only in if the alarm count is greater one. Battery Circle: The pie diagram shows the battery juice. The notification count is shown on the dial of the battery circle. Note that the notifcation count indicator only kicks in if the phone is connected. Intelligent intensity minutes goal: Typically garmin shows the weekly goal and you get a checkmark if the weekly goal is reached. This setting divides the goal through 7 and multiplies it with the weekday. Example: weekly goal: 210 minutes. On monday you have to reach 30 minutes, on tuesday the goal is set to 60, on wednesday to 90 and so on. If you have 90 intensity minutes already on monday you will get a checkmark on tuesday and wednesday as well.
